Bowman, 27, was a Rule 5 Draft pick by St. Louis from the Mets before the 2016 season and spent the last three seasons in the Cardinals' bullpen. Over 156 games, he is 5-13 with a 4.10 ERA and 1.27 WHIP.
In 74 games during his rookie year, Dixon batted .178 with five home runs and 10 RBIs.
Brice was 2-3 with a 5.79 ERA in 33 big league games over four stints with the Reds last season.
